生物降解材料聚乙醇酸及乙醇酸共聚物的新发展

摘    要:介绍了生物降解性材料聚乙醇酸及乙醇酸共聚物的发展现状,综述了聚乙醇酸的合成、乙交酯的纯化、乙醇酸聚合催化剂的选择、乙醇酸聚合物的降解机理、乙醇酸均聚和共聚改性及乙醇酸共聚物在生物医学领域和生态学领域的应用,并讨论了乙醇酸共聚物的发展前景。

关 键 词:乙交酯  聚乙交酯:生物降解性材料  药物释放体系

New Development of Biodegradable Material--Glycollic Acid and Its Copolymers

Abstract:The present situations of developments of polyglycollic acid (PGA) polymer and copolymers were introduced.It was summarized on the subject of:synthesis of PGA polymer from cyclic diester,purification of glycolide,initiators used in glycolide polymerization,biodegradable mechanism of PGA,homo-/copolymers of glycolide and its applications in medicine,pharmacy and ecology.The developing prospects of those biodegradable materials were also discussed.
Keywords:Glycolide  Polyglycolide  Biodegradable material  Drug delivery
